Scenic Brook Estates Neighborhood Guide
An Overview of the Community
Located southwest of downtown Austin, Scenic Brook Estates sits between the two Circle Drive entrances off US 290 (ZIP codes 78735 and 78736). The neighborhood’s rare 1 to 5-acre lots make it an exceptional destination for those who value land and privacy over the constraints of an HOA. With no association dictating improvements, you’ll find everything from elegant stone ranch homes to contemporary gated estates.
Mature trees create a classic Hill Country feel, with side streets that wind past homes featuring stone driveways, rainwater collection systems, and even private gates. Some streets include curbs, but you won’t find sidewalks, which preserves the area’s open and rural flavor.
Quick facts
- Lot sizes span 1 to 5 acres
- Homes range from 2 to 5 bedrooms and 1 to 5 bathrooms
- Square footages run from just over 1,000 up to nearly 6,000 sq ft
- Typical home features 4 beds, 3 baths, about 2,279 sq ft, and 1.25 acres
- Many homes built from the 1970s to today, with a wide range of layouts and finishes

Commute and Connectivity
One of the key advantages is the short commute for such a rural feel. Residents can typically reach:
- Downtown Austin in roughly 18–22 minutes by car via US 290
- Barton Creek Square’s shopping and dining outlets in 10–15 minutes
- Austin-Bergstrom International Airport in around 25–30 minutes
- Major tech employers, both north and south, with minimal hassle

Scenic Brook Estates Property Tax Rate
The property tax rate in Southwest Austin’s Scenic Brook Estates neighborhood is 1.4035% as of the 2023 tax year, down from 1.5572% as of the 2022 tax year. The property tax rate was 1.7007% as of the 2021 tax year.
Scenic Brook Estates Schools
Kids who live in Southwest Austin’s Scenic Brook Estates neighborhood are served by the Austin ISD and will likely attend the following schools:
- Oak Hill Elementary - 5/10
- Small Middle - 7/10
- Bowie High - 8/10
School ratings reflect Great Schools ratings as of January 2025. Ratings are subject to change at any time. Please verify ratings and boundaries with the school district.
